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Basics Course Catalog
- Status: Free Trial
University of Michigan
Skills you'll gain: Object Oriented Programming (OOP), Computer Programming, Program Development, Python Programming, Programming Principles
Skills you'll gain: Natural Language Processing, Python Programming, Text Mining, Artificial Intelligence, Machine Learning, Applied Machine Learning, Data Collection, Data Processing, Data Analysis
Coursera Project Network
Skills you'll gain: PHP (Scripting Language), Object Oriented Programming (OOP), Object Oriented Design, Software Design Patterns, Web Development, Maintainability, Software Engineering
- Status: Free Trial
Skills you'll gain: Rust (Programming Language), Data Structures, Package and Software Management, Maintainability, Algorithms, Software Testing, Software Design Patterns, Development Testing
- Status: Preview
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Scalability, Scala Programming, Distributed Computing, Event-Driven Programming, System Design and Implementation, Microservices, Software Architecture, Software Design Patterns, Cloud Computing, Software Design, Middleware, Application Frameworks
- Status: NewStatus: Free Trial
Skills you'll gain: Photo Editing, Photography, Adobe Creative Cloud, Editing, Color Theory, Data Import/Export
- Status: NewStatus: Preview
Universidades Anáhuac
Skills you'll gain: Office Procedures, Interviewing Skills
- Status: Free Trial
Duke University
Skills you'll gain: Java Programming, Object Oriented Programming (OOP), Data Structures, Java, Cryptography, Software Engineering, Algorithms, Encryption, Programming Principles, Data Analysis, Web Servers, Statistical Methods, File Management, Debugging
Skills you'll gain: Performance Tuning, Python Programming, Distributed Computing, OS Process Management, Scalability, Web Scraping, Database Management
- Status: Free Trial
Skills you'll gain: Selenium (Software), Web Development Tools, Cascading Style Sheets (CSS), Java Programming, Extensible Markup Language (XML), Data Import/Export, Test Automation, Apache, Debugging, File Management, Programming Principles
- Status: New
Skills you'll gain: Video Editing, Adobe Premiere, Post-Production, Timelines, Editing, File Management
- Status: NewStatus: Preview
Knowledge Accelerators
Skills you'll gain: Data Presentation, Data Literacy, Data Visualization Software, Collaborative Software, Data Sharing, Data-Driven Decision-Making, Data Analysis, Data Management, Business Intelligence, Organizational Skills, Customer Data Management, Record Keeping, Data Science, Business Analytics, Financial Analysis, Marketing Planning, Project Management, Event Planning
Programming Basics learners also search
In summary, here are 10 of our most popular programming basics courses
- The Power of Object-Oriented Programming: University of Michigan
- Basics of Chatbots with Machine Learning & Python: Packt
- Learn Object-Oriented Programming with PHP: Coursera Project Network
- Intermediate Rust Programming and Advanced Concepts: Packt
- Programming Reactive Systems (Scala 2 version): École Polytechnique Fédérale de Lausanne
- Adobe Lightroom Essentials Pt. 1: Editing & Color Basics: Skillshare
- Spanish for the Workplace: From basics to business: Universidades Anáhuac
- Java Programming: Arrays, Lists, and Structured Data: Duke University
- Concurrent and Parallel Programming in Python: Packt
- Advanced Java Programming and Web Development: Packt